China’s
Auto Production Rises Sharply in First Half of 2025Beijing,
10 Jul (ONA) – The People’s Republic of China’s automobile production and sales
grew by more than 10% in the first half of 2025, signaling a strong rebound in
consumer spending, according to data released today by the China Association of
Automobile Manufacturers (CAAM).Between
January and June 2025, total vehicle production reached 15.62 million units,
marking a 12.5% increase compared to the same period last year. Vehicle sales
also rose by 11.4%, totaling 15.65 million units.The
production of new energy vehicles (NEVs) — including electric and hybrid cars —
saw particularly rapid growth, with output increasing 41.4% year-on-year to
6.97 million units. Sales of NEVs climbed 40.3%, reaching approximately 6.94
million units in the same period.These
figures reflect growing demand and robust momentum in the People’s Republic of
China’s push toward cleaner, more sustainable transportation.
